Bio: John is the founder and Editor in Chief at DSOGaming. He is a PC gaming fan and highly supports the modding and indie communities. Before creating DSOGaming, John worked on numerous gaming websites. While he is a die-hard PC gamer, his gaming roots can be found on consoles. John loved - and still does - the 16-bit consoles, and considers SNES to be one of the best consoles. Still, the PC platform won him over consoles. That was mainly due to 3DFX and its iconic dedicated 3D accelerator graphics card, Voodoo 2. John has also written a higher degree thesis on the "The Evolution of PC graphics cards." Contact: Email

The time has finally come and so have I. Modder ‘onnoj’ has released Echelon Renderer for Deus Ex, which adds support for RTX Remix Path Tracing. Yes, you can now enjoy the classic first-person immersive sim PC game with Path Tracing. And it looks glorious.

Nightdive Studios has announced a remaster for the 1995 first-person shooter, PO’ed. PO’ed: Definitive Edition will feature updated visuals, antialiasing, increased framerate and redefined controls.

Modder ‘LukeYui’ has released a new cool co-op mod for FromSoftware’s latest title, Armored Core 6. As its name implies, this mod adds unofficial online co-operative multiplayer functionalities to the game.

A couple of days ago, Capcom released the first post-launch update for Dragon’s Dogma 2. And, alongside its image improvements to DLSS Super Resolution, this patch also improved overall performance on PC.

Electronic Arts and DICE revealed that Battlefield 5 will get support for EA Anticheat on April 3rd. This new anti-cheat system aims to stop cheaters from ruining the game. The latest BF games already use it, and now so will BF5.
